Braking Systems

Electric dynamic braking, forced air over quiet stainless steel resistor

grids with dry disc service and secondary braking system.

Electric dynamic braking

__

Max: 3,300 kW / 4,425 HP

Full dynamic braking down to zero. Single-

pedal, automatic brake blending with ser-

vice brakes from 0.8 km/hr / 0.5 mph to

zero

Steering

Ackermann center point lever system, full hydraulic power steering

with accumulator safety backup. Isolated from dump hydraulic system.

Two double-acting hydraulic cylinders.

Dump System

Two double-stage, double-acting hoist cylinders with inter-stage and

end cushioning in both directions. Electronic joystick with integrated

engine high-idle switch and full modulating control in both extend and

retract.

Dump angle

____________________

49° (45° with optional kick-out switch)

Cycle times

_____________________

20 seconds – Power Extend “Power Up”

11 seconds – Power Retract “Power Down”

14 seconds – Retract to Frame
